Alaska® 88E1116R Technical Product Brief
Gigabit Ethernet Transceiver
Table 9: Power & Ground

Analog supply. 1.8V1. AVDD can be supplied externally with 1.8V, or via the
1.8V regulator.
Analog supply - 1.8V or 2.5V, or 3.3V2.
AVDDC must be supplied externally. Do not use the 1.8V regulator to power
AVDDC.

1.2V Regulator supply - 1.8V
AVDDR can be supplied externally with 1.8V, or via the 1.8V regulator. If the
1.2V regulator is not used, AVDDR must still be tied to 1.8V.

Power 1.8V Regulator supply - 2.5V, 3.3V, (or 1.8V).
AVDDX must be supplied externally. Note that this supply must be the same
voltage as AVDDC.
If the 1.8V regulator is not used, then it means a 1.8V supply is in the sys-
tem. AVDDX (along with AVDDC) would be tied to 1.8V in this case.

Ground to device. The 64-pin QFN package has an exposed die pad (E-
PAD) at its base. This E-PAD must be soldered to VSS.
Refer to the package mechanical drawings for the exact location and dimen-
sions of the EPAD.

No connect. These pins are not connected to the die so they can be con-
nected to anything on the board.
1. AVDD supplies the MDIP/N[3:0] pins.
2. AVDDC supplies the XTAL_IN and XTAL_OUT pins.
3. VDDO supplies the MDC, MDIO, RESETn, LED[2:0], CONFIG[3:0], TDI, TMS, TCK, TRSTn, TDO, DIS_REG12,
CTRL18, HSDAC, and TSTPT
4. VDDOR supplies the TXD[3:0], TX_CLK, TX_CTRL, RXD[3:0], RX_CLK, and RX_CTRL pins.
5. Pin 28 must be connected to AVDD in Revision A0. Refer to the Rev A0 Release Notes for Pin 28 connection
details.
